LIST OF ATTACHMENTSSTRUCTURAL ANALYSIS OF BLADES<br />

E.10 Deflection analysis<br />

According to IEC 61400-2 it shall be verified that no deflections affecting the wind tur-<br />

bine’s safety occur in the design load cases. One of the most important considerations is to<br />

verify that no mechanical interference between the blade and tower can occur, that is, no<br />

part of the blade shall hit the tower under any of the design load cases. Verification is ac-<br />

complished through a critical deflection analysis, which checks the serviceability limit<br />

state by comparing the no-load clearance LTB of figure E.42 with the maximum tip deflec-<br />

tion.<br />

Figure E.42: No-load clearance between blade and tower<br />

The largest radial blade deflection (in the x-direction of figure E.42) occurs in load case C.<br />

Figure E.43 below shows the deflection in mm.<br />
